Sea to Sky Gondola
Enjoy the beautiful mountain peaks and views over Howe Sound and the surrounding forests as you get ready to move with intention preparing your body and mind to tackle whatever the day has ahead - climbing mountains, swimming in lakes or enjoying yoga-apres at the lodge!
Classes run from 9.30-10.30 Thursdays and Fridays from May 21st to October 2nd.
Squamish Canyon
Join us for exclusive early access to the Forest Lounge immersed under the spectacular canopy of mossy trees. Move with us, before the boardwalk is open to anyone else… well, there’s always potential that the canyon residents 🐿️ 🐻 may stroll by for a visit.
Early season classes run Wednesdays & Sundays from May 6th, 9-10am. Full series Classes run Sundays & Tuesdays from 9-10am, from May 17th to September 29th.

There is travel time involved to both locations so please arrive with enough time to purchase tickets and get to class a couple minute early to be settled when we begin.
Gondola: The ride takes around 12 minutes to reach the lodge.
Canyon: The forest lounge is approximately 1km along the board walk.
-
Squamish weather can change quickly. Please be prepared with a hat and sunscreen for sunny days, and warm layers for cooler days. Sometimes you may need both! You may also like to bring a small towel or shirt to lay over your face during Savasana.

Yes! Many of our guests are first time yoga students who want to experience a class in an incredible location.
Our classes are All-Levels. This means we offer options for a range of bodys and experience - aiming to support both the yoga curious and the more advanced practitioners in their practice.

Classes are on Rain or Shine! At the Gondola we move class to the diamond head deck, under the canvas shelter. At the canyon, we erect shelters for the class.
